diff options
| author | Shpuld Shpludson <shp@cock.li> | 2018-12-13 14:41:57 +0000 |
|---|---|---|
| committer | Shpuld Shpludson <shp@cock.li> | 2018-12-13 14:41:57 +0000 |
| commit | c824d2537884fb736ce7fe1263875b87d3c00c81 (patch) | |
| tree | cd249ba00e33b6364f361f152f9c94f7a1f00805 /src/modules/users.js | |
| parent | ad905576fc7e60aa91f1ffabb84ce3e383b4539e (diff) | |
| parent | fa7c3c20970f8a31e064d5591b9e0814a5cf1512 (diff) | |
Merge branch 'fix_empty_profiles' into 'develop'
Improved user profile display
Closes #82
See merge request pleroma/pleroma-fe!414
Diffstat (limited to 'src/modules/users.js')
| -rw-r--r-- | src/modules/users.js |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/src/modules/users.js b/src/modules/users.js index d2ac95cd..25d1c81f 100644 --- a/src/modules/users.js +++ b/src/modules/users.js @@ -17,6 +17,9 @@ export const mergeOrAdd = (arr, obj, item) => { // This is a new item, prepare it arr.push(item) obj[item.id] = item + if (item.screen_name && !item.screen_name.includes('@')) { + obj[item.screen_name] = item + } return { item, new: true } } } @@ -87,7 +90,7 @@ const users = { actions: { fetchUser (store, id) { store.rootState.api.backendInteractor.fetchUser({ id }) - .then((user) => store.commit('addNewUsers', user)) + .then((user) => store.commit('addNewUsers', [user])) }, registerPushNotifications (store) { const token = store.state.currentUser.credentials |
